Leasing is fundamentally a sales role dressed in hospitality clothing, and the best consultants know how to hold both at once. At Evolve South Bay in Carson, this position leans on three skills more than anything else: the ability to read a prospect quickly and match them to the right unit, the organizational discipline to keep rental files and lease documentation clean and current, and the interpersonal range to shift from closing a new lease to resolving a resident complaint without losing composure.
Day to day, you're the first face prospective residents see when they walk through the door. That first impression carries real weight on occupancy numbers. You'll qualify applicants, prepare leases, and coordinate with the maintenance team to make sure move-ins go smoothly rather than chaotically. On the administrative side, you'll manage rental data entry, keep files organized, and assist with monthly reporting tasks. When residents have maintenance concerns or payment issues, you're often the first point of contact before those situations escalate.
The Carson submarket sits within the South Bay, a competitive corridor where renters have real options across a range of price points and property classes. Holding occupancy here means your leasing skills need to be sharp, not just your product knowledge. Traffic that walks through the door is worth converting, and the ability to handle objections professionally without overselling makes a measurable difference.
What separates strong candidates from average ones in this role isn't charm alone. It's the combination of sales instincts and back-office accuracy. Leasing consultants who can close traffic while also maintaining clean files and accurate data entry are the ones who get promoted. MG Properties has a stated focus on internal advancement, and this role is a realistic entry point into assistant manager or property manager positions for someone who takes the administrative side as seriously as the leasing floor.
The pay range runs $22 to $25 per hour depending on experience, with monthly bonuses and company profit sharing on top of base. MG Properties has operated across the Western U.S. for over three decades, with a track record that spans acquisition, development, rehabilitation, and third-party management. The benefit package includes medical, dental, vision, 401(k) with employer match, paid holidays, sick time, and rental discounts.
